In Roland, Tasmania, residents have access to a variety of shopping options, including local convenience stores and small businesses catering to everyday needs. For a broader shopping experience, residents often make the short trip to nearby towns like Sheffield, known for its boutique shops and art galleries.

The suburb is home to a mix of primary and secondary schools, providing quality education for local children. Primary schools in the area include Roland Primary School, which offers a comprehensive curriculum and a supportive learning environment. For secondary education, students may attend Kentish District High School in nearby town of Sheffield, recognised for its academic programs and extracurricular activities.

Surrounded by lush greenery and natural beauty, Roland offers a peaceful and picturesque setting for residents to enjoy. The suburb is nestled in the Kentish region, known for its stunning countryside, with scenic views of rolling hills, forests, and farmland. Residents can explore nearby parks like Mount Roland Regional Reserve, offering hiking trails and opportunities for outdoor recreation amidst the tranquil surroundings.
